Frozen in Neglect: Family Sues After ICE Release Death

In the biting cold of a Pittsburgh winter, a tragedy unfolded that has sparked outrage and sorrow. Daphy Michel, a Haitian asylum seeker, was found dead from hypothermia just days after being released from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) custody. She had been dropped off at a bus station in freezing temperatures, wearing only summer clothes. Her family, grappling with immense grief, has announced plans to sue the U.S. government, alleging that her death was preventable and the result of systemic neglect.

The medical examiner ruled Michel’s death a homicide, citing hypothermia as the cause. She had been suffering from severe mental illness and was vulnerable in the harsh weather conditions. According to reports, ICE agents released her without ensuring she had appropriate clothing or a safe place to go. This lack of basic care has raised serious questions about the agency’s protocols for handling detainees with health issues.

Michel’s story is not isolated. It highlights broader concerns about the treatment of immigrants in U.S. custody, particularly those with mental health challenges. Advocates argue that the system often fails to provide adequate support, leaving individuals exposed to danger upon release. Her death has become a symbol of these failures, prompting calls for reform and greater accountability.

The lawsuit aims to hold the government responsible for what the family describes as gross negligence. They argue that ICE had a duty of care to ensure Michel’s safety, especially given her known vulnerabilities. By releasing her into life-threatening conditions without proper preparation, the agency allegedly breached this duty. The case could set a precedent for how immigration authorities handle similar situations in the future.
